    Installed this mugen replica intake!
    Couldn't properly test it because of the rain. Had 1 or 2 WOTs and was shocked by the extra performance. The noise was brilliant and i did feel more power! One of the best $450 I've spent on the car!
    It didn't come with instructions and was a slight effort squishing it in and bolting it up. But it is solid and a good piece of kit. Well worth the time taken of 3 hours with my GF helping me out.
    It's a Tegiwa replica if anyone is interested to know. Ill post another pic showing it fully finished tomorrow!
